Key Buying Factors for Laser Hair Growth Comb for Home Use
Light Technology
Look for low-level laser therapy or red light in the wavelength range the brand clearly states. Better listing detail is helpful because it shows the manufacturer is being specific about what the device does.
FDA Clearance
FDA-cleared products can offer extra reassurance for buyers who want a more established option. Clearance does not guarantee results, but it does help distinguish more credible devices from vague wellness gadgets.
Comfort and Ease of Use
If a device is awkward to hold or heavy during treatment, you’re less likely to use it consistently. For home use, cordless designs, simple controls, and comfortable comb teeth can make a real difference.
Hair Type and Scalp Coverage
Choose a design that matches your hair length, density, and sensitivity. Some users prefer traditional comb-style contact, while others may like brush-style or vibrating models for a gentler feel.
Session Routine and Portability
A good home device should fit into a realistic routine. If you travel often or want to use it while multitasking, battery life and compact size matter as much as the therapy format.
